.padding-normal{padding-right:6px!important;padding-left:6px!important}
.shadow-box{}
.text-hover{transition:.2s}
.text-hover:hover{color:#ffb81c!important}
.text-fars{color:#ffb81c}
body { background: #f1f1f1 !important}


.top-news img{width:100%}
.top-news .detalis{background:linear-gradient(to bottom,rgba(0,0,0,0) 0%,rgba(0,0,0,.6) 30%,rgba(0,0,0,.8) 80%,rgba(0,0,0,1) 100%);position:absolute;bottom:0;display:block;width:100%!important}
.top-news .detalis h3{font-size:1.5rem;color:#fff;padding:.75rem;margin:0}
.top-news-list .detalis .title{font-size:1rem;line-height:1.4;font-weight:700;text-align:left;color:#333;display:block}
.top-news-list .detalis .info{font-size:13px;display:flex;color:#919191;align-items:center;white-space:nowrap}



.multi-item-img .item article{height:40px;overflow:hidden}
.multi-item-img .first img{width:100%;transition:.2s}
.multi-item-img .first span{display:block;font-size:1rem;font-weight:700;color:#333;transition:.2s;height:83px;overflow:hidden}
.multi-item-img .first:hover img{filter:brightness(110%) contrast(110%)}
.multi-item-img .first:hover span{color:#385e9d}
.multi-item-img .item{height:53px;overflow:hidden;;color:#333;display:inline-flex;padding:.25rem 1rem}
.multi-item-img .item::before{color:#ffb81c;content:"◆";margin:9px 10px 0 0;font-size:8px}
.multi-item-img .item a{ color: #4f4d4d;font-size: .8rem; display: block; line-height: 1.3; margin: 5px 0 0 0;}



.news-item .img img{width:100%;transition:.2s}
.news-item:hover .img img{filter:brightness(110%) contrast(110%)}
.news-item{background-color:#fff}
.news-item .body{min-height:145px;position:relative}
.news-item .body .title{color:#333;font-size:1rem;transition:.3s;display:block;line-height:1.4}
.news-item:hover .body .title a{color:#ffb81c!important}
.news-item .body .title a{transition:.3s}
.news-item .info{font-size:13px;display:flex;color:#919191;align-items:center}
.news-item .info i{margin-right:5px}



.photo-back{background:#25282a}
.titr-photo .titr{font-size:20px;font-weight:700;padding-left:.5rem;white-space:nowrap}
.titr-photo .titr a::after  {position: absolute;top: 6px;left: -9px;background: #ffb81c;content: ' ';width: 4px;height: 100%;border-radius: 8px 0 8px 0;z-index: 1;}
.titr-photo .titr a::before {position: absolute;top: -5px;left: -9px;background: #385e9d;content: ' ';width: 4px;height: 100%;border-radius: 8px 0 8px 0;z-index: 1;}
.titr-photo .titr a { display: block; position: relative; padding: 0 0 0 12px}
.titr-photo .icone{text-align:right;display:block;width: 100%; display: flex; justify-content: end}
.titr-photo .icone i { background: #ffb81c; width: 25px; height: 25px; color: #fff; display: flex; align-items: center; justify-content: center; border-radius: 4px 0 4px 0}
.photo-big-item{position:relative}
.photo-big-item .category{z-index:2;position:absolute;display:inline-flex;justify-content:center;align-items:center;color:#fff;background-color:#000;width:34px;height:34px;font-size: 18px; right: 0; border-radius: 4px 0 4px 0}
.photo-big-item img{width:100%;transition:.3s}
.photo-big-item .titr{font-size:1.3rem;background:linear-gradient(to bottom,rgba(0,0,0,0) 0%,rgba(0,0,0,.6) 30%,rgba(0,0,0,.8) 80%,rgba(0,0,0,1) 100%);width:100%;position:absolute;bottom:0;right:0;display:flex;align-items:flex-end;overflow:hidden;padding:0 .5rem;color:#fff}
.photo-big-item:hover img{filter:brightness(110%) contrast(110%)}
.photo-small-item{position:relative}
.photo-small-item .category{z-index: 2; right: 0; position:absolute;display:inline-flex;justify-content:center;align-items:center;color:#fff;background-color:#000;width:34px;height:34px;font-size: 18px;border-radius: 4px 0 4px 0}
.photo-small-item img{width:100%;transition:.3s}
.photo-small-item .titr{font-size:1rem;transition:.3s;color:#fff;margin:10px 0 0;height:50px;overflow:hidden;display:flex}
.photo-small-item .titr::before{color:#ffb81c;content:"◆";margin:5px 10px 0 0;font-size:8px}
.photo-small-item .time{transition:.3s;display:flex;border-left:3px solid #ffb81c;padding-left:3px;color:#9b9999!important;margin-top:5px;direction:ltr;font-size:.85rem}
.photo-small-item:hover img{filter:brightness(110%) contrast(110%)}
.photo-small-item:hover .titr,.photo-small-item:hover .time{color:#ffb81c}



.news-with-img .title .text{font-size:20px;font-weight:700;padding-left: 5px; position: relative; padding-left: 15px}
.news-with-img .title .text::after  {position: absolute;top: 6px;left: 0;background: #ffb81c;content: ' ';width: 4px;height: 100%;border-radius: 8px 0 8px 0;z-index: 1;}
.news-with-img .title .text::before {position: absolute;top: -5px;left: 0;background: #385e9d;content: ' ';width: 4px;height: 100%;border-radius: 8px 0 8px 0;z-index: 1;}
.news-with-img .title .icon{display:inline-flex;justify-content:center;align-items:center;background-color:#385e9d;color:#fff;width:26px;height:26px;font-size: 23px; border-radius: 4px 0 4px 0}
.news-with-img .first{background-color:#fff}
.news-with-img .first:hover img{filter:brightness(110%) contrast(110%)}
.news-with-img .first:hover .titr{color:#ffb81c}
.news-with-img .first img{width:100%;transition:.4s}
.news-with-img .first .titr{color:#333;font-size:16px;font-weight:700;padding:10px 5px;display:flex;transition:.4s;height:61px ; overflow: hidden}
.news-with-img ul li{background-color:#fff;padding:8px 5px;display:flex;font-size:14px;height:50px}
.news-with-img ul li a{color:#4f4d4d;display:flex;align-items:start;line-height:1.3!important;max-height:37px;overflow:hidden}
.news-with-img ul li a::before{color:#ffb81c;content:"◆";margin:6px 10px 0 5px;font-size:8px}



.video-back{background:#25282a}
.titr-video .titr{font-size:20px;font-weight:700;padding-left: 1rem; position: relative}
.titr-video .titr a::after  {position: absolute;top: 6px;left: -9px;background: #ffb81c;content: ' ';width: 4px;height: 100%;border-radius: 8px 0 8px 0;z-index: 1;}
.titr-video .titr a::before {position: absolute;top: -5px;left: -9px;background: #385e9d;content: ' ';width: 4px;height: 100%;border-radius: 8px 0 8px 0;z-index: 1;}
.titr-video .icone{text-align:right;display:block;width: 100%; display: flex; align-items: center; justify-content: center; width: 24px; height:24px; background: #ffb81c; border-radius: 4px 0 4px 0; color: #fff
}
.video-big-item{position:relative}
.video-big-item .category{z-index:2;position:absolute;display:inline-flex;justify-content:center;bottom:5px;left:5px;align-items:center;color:#fff;width:34px;height:46px;font-size:16px}
.video-big-item img{width:100%;transition:.3s}
.video-big-item .titr{background: linear-gradient(to bottom, rgba(0, 0, 0, 0) 0%, rgba(0, 0, 0, .6) 30%, rgba(0, 0, 0, .8) 80%, rgba(0, 0, 0, 1) 100%); transition: 0.3s;width:100%;position:absolute;font-size:1.3rem;bottom:0;right:0;height:55px;display:flex;align-items:start;overflow:hidden;padding:0 .5rem 0 2.7rem;color:#fff;line-height:1.2}
.video-big-item:hover .titr { color: #ffb81c}
.video-big-item:hover img{filter:brightness(110%) contrast(110%)}
.video-small-item{position:relative}
.video-small-item .category{z-index:2;position:absolute;display:inline-flex;justify-content:center;bottom:5px;left:5px;align-items:center;color:#fff;width:34px;height:34px;font-size:16px}
.video-small-item img{width:100%;transition:.3s}
.video-small-item .titr{width:100%;bottom: 0; transition: 0.3s; right:0;height:45px;display:flex;align-items:center;overflow:hidden;padding:0 .25rem;color:#fff;font-size:14px;display:flex;align-items:start}
.video-small-item:hover .titr { color: #ffb81c}
.video-small-item:hover img{filter:brightness(110%) contrast(110%)}
.video-small-item .shadow .back{background:linear-gradient(to bottom,rgba(0,0,0,0) 0%,rgba(0,0,0,.6) 30%,rgba(0,0,0,.8) 80%,rgba(0,0,0,1) 100%);height:35px;width:100%;bottom:0;right:0;display:block;position:absolute}


.last-tweet { height: 258px}
.last-tweet .bord::before{content:' ';background:#385e9d;width:2px;left:-7px;position:absolute;top:5px;height:85%}
.last-tweet .live{font-weight:700;font-size:18px;color:#ffb81c}
.last-tweet .live::before{content:' ';width:21px;height:21px;left:-16px;background-color:#385e9d;position:absolute;border-radius:100%;top:3px}
.last-tweet .live::after{content:' ';width:13px;height:13px;left:-12px;background-color:#385e9d;animation:mymove 2s infinite;position:absolute;border-radius:100%;top:7px;border:3px solid #f1f1f1}
.last-tweet ul li{position:relative;padding-left:6px;font-size:.82rem;color:#8a8a95;padding-top:8px}
.last-tweet ul li a{color:#686868}
.last-tweet ul li:nth-child(2){margin-top:10px}
.last-tweet ul li::before{content:' ';width:10px;height:10px;left:-11px;background-color:#385e9d;position:absolute;border-radius:100%;top:10px}
.last-tweet ul li:first-child{font-weight:100;font-size:1rem;color:#333}
.last-tweet ul li:first-child a{font-weight:100;font-size:.95rem;color:#333}
.last-tweet ul li:first-child::before{display:none}
.last-tweet ul li span{font-size:.88rem;color:#385e9d}
.last-tweet{background-color:#fff!important}
.last-tweet ul li a{transition:.4s;max-height:40px;overflow:hidden}
.last-tweet ul li a:hover{color:#385e9d!important}



.other-sites .section-title{font:18px Arial!important;color:#ffb81c;border-left:4px solid #333!important;padding-left:4px;line-height:24px}
.other-sites .site-name a{font-family:IRANSans;font-size:15px;font-weight:700;color:#333;line-height:19px}
.other-sites .site-name.rtl{border-right:4px solid #ffb81c!important;padding-right:4px}
.other-sites .site-name.ltr{border-left:4px solid #ffb81c!important;padding-left:4px}
.other-sites .news .title{font-family:IRANSans;font-size:12px;font-weight:700;color:#333}



.visit-chosen .tab-content{overflow-y:hidden;background:#fff}
.news-list-small h3{font-size:13px!important;margin:1px 0;display:flex;padding:0 25px 0 0}
.news-list-small li{margin:13px 0 0}
.news-list-small li a{transition:.3s;color:#333}
.news-list-small li:hover a{color:#385e9d!important}
.visit-chosen .nav-item a{display:flex;justify-content:center;align-items:center;width:100%}
.visit-chosen .nav-item h2{font-size:12px;white-space:nowrap;margin-bottom:0!important;display:flex;width:100%;height:100%;align-items:center;justify-content:center;font-weight: bold}
.font-fars{font-size:inherit!important;line-height:1.1!important}
.news-list-small h3::before{color:#ffb81c;content:"◆";margin:5px 10px 0 0;font-size:8px}
.most .nav-tabs .active{background:#ffb81c !important ;color:#fff!important}
.most .nav-tabs .nav-item{height:25px}
.most .nav-tabs .nav-link{background:#385e9d;height:25px;border:none!important;-ms-border-radius:0!important;border-radius:0!important;padding:0!important;color:#fff;font:13px irsans-bold}
.links{background:#404040}
.links ul{list-style:none}
.links ul li a{color:#fff;font:14px irsans}
.links span a{color:#f94100}
.nav-tabs .nav-link{background:#686868;height:25px;border-right:1px solid #fff;border-left:none!important;border-top:none!important;border-bottom:none!important;-ms-border-radius:0!important;border-radius:0!important;padding:0!important;color:#fff;font:11px bold}
.nav-tabs .active{background:#333!important;color:#385e9d!important}
.tab-content{overflow-y:hidden;background:#fff}
.item-list li{text-align:left;font-size:.8rem;color:#4f4d4d!important;font-family:Arial!important;margin-bottom:6px;display:flex}
.item-list li::before{color:#385e9d;content:"◆";margin:5px 10px 0 0;font-size:8px}
.nav-tabs .nav-link{font-family:Arial!important}


@media (max-width: 1200px) {
.container,.container-lg,.container-md,.container-sm,.container-xl{max-width:1200px}
}
.top-link{position:absolute;background:#385e9d;color:#fff!important;top:0;left:0;z-index:2;font-size:12px;padding:3px 8px}

@media (max-width: 1300px) {
.multi-item-img .item{height:44.3px!important}
}
@media (max-width: 1280px) {
.height-max{max-height: 322px!important}
}
@media (max-width: 768px) {
.top-news-list .detalis .title{font-size:.9rem}
.top-news-list .cat{display:none}
    .top-news .detalis h3 { font-size: 1.2rem}
}
@keyframes mymove {
from{background-color:#385e9d}
to{background-color:#f1f1f1}
}